Van Nuys woman, 22, fatally struck by alleged DUI driver on Sepulveda Blvd. sidewalk

VAN NUYS — A 22-year-old Van Nuys woman died early Sunday after an alleged drunken driver struck her as she walked along a Sepulveda Boulevard sidewalk, authorities said.
Haley Dawn Coreas died in the 12:45 a.m. crash in the 6300 block of Sepulveda Boulevard, just south if Victory Boulevard, Los Angeles County Department of Coroner Investigator Betsy Magdaleno said.
The woman was walking on a sidewalk in front of a recreational vehicle rental business when she was struck by a Toyota 4Runner SUV.
“A suspected DUI vehicle traveling southbound Sepulveda, south of Victory, went off the roadway (and) collided with a pedestrian on the sidewalk,” Los Angeles police Officer Sally Madera said.
Los Angeles Fire Department paramedics pronounced Coreas dead at the scene at 1:05 a.m., Magdaleno said.
“The driver of the vehicle was taken into custody,” Madera said.
The identity of the suspected DUI driver was not available Sunday. It was unclear whether the driver was injured the crash.
The investigation was be handled by the LAPD’s Valley Traffic Division.
